Title:
|
 |
Crystal structure of porcine mitochondrial respiratory complex ii bound with oxaloacetate and pentachlorophenol
|
|
Structure:
|
 |
Succinate dehydrogenase [ubiquinone] flavoprotein subunit, mitochondrial. Chain: a. Synonym: flavoprotein subunit of complex ii, fp. Succinate dehydrogenase [ubiquinone] iron-sulfur subunit, mitochondrial. Chain: b. Synonym: iron-sulf protein, iron-sulfur subunit of complex ii, ip. Succinate dehydrogenase cytochrome b560 subunit,
